Nemanja Vidic and Rio Ferdinand give Manchester United injury worries

by admin on October 30, 2009


The Manchester United manager Sir Alex Ferguson has problems defensively against the Premier League match against Blackburn at Old Trafford tomorrow.

Nemanja Vidic and Rio Ferdinand is doubtful with a calf problem and Gary Neville will be suspended. Ryan Giggs has also taken and Danny Welbeck, scored in the Carling Cup win against Barnsley in the week, pausing with a knee injury.

“We have some doubts for tomorrow,” said Ferguson. “Ryan Giggs is a doubt, but we hope it will have to be in order. Ferdinand and Vidic both doubts – we’ll see how they are today. Gary Neville is suspended from the course. I hope we can have one or two adjustments for tomorrow, but we are facing a difficult task.

“Vidic had a calf problem for several weeks. We saw a specialist, so we’ll see how it is today. Vida and Rio both want after the disappointment of last Sunday [to play the 0-2 defeat against Liverpool].”
